    Quote Originally Posted by nipon621 View Post
    Don't have cooking...
    Drop the corpse on the ground, then fire bolt or ball it until you see a message about the heat cooking it. At this point, more fire will destroy it instead. Success rate depends on B/U/C status - blessed corpses take more zaps to be affected. This works on every cookable food item except fish meat.
